Alternative Inserts for Pocket? by kiwibirder in PaperRepublic

[–]rpb_65 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Any Field Notes sized book will fit. I have some from William Hannah (UK) that have superb paper for fountain pens (FP) and you could try any 'high quality paper' ones from Muji as they are good for FP. As long as it's the high quality paper you'll be good.
